The procedure of university admissions has become increasingly sophisticated, demanding students to demonstrate not solely scholarly excellence but also also individual traits and potential for input to the institutional community. Admissions panels here evaluate a comprehensive range of factors, including academic records, standardized exam scores, individual narratives, and recommendation letters. Several schools have implemented holistic admissions methods that consider the entire applicant rather than focusing solely on numerical metrics. This transition acknowledges that scholarly success requires various factors and that diverse perspectives boost the academic atmosphere for all learners.
